Is there street cleaning when it rains?

Street sweeping may or may not occur on rainy days. If the streets are too wet, sweepers cannot remove debris. It is advised that you always move your vehicle in accordance with the posted street sweeping signs. Remember: Only rain in the drain.

Do street sweepers have cameras?

Street sweepers are equipped with automated camera systems with LPR capabilities. The camera systems use LPR technology to automatically detect illegally parked vehicles and record a picture of the vehicle's license plate and of the vehicle and its surrounding environment.

What happens if you don't move your car for street cleaning?

When cars are not removed, the street sweepers are not able to thoroughly clean the area. They must move around the vehicles and leave dirty stretches of road. Not only does this ruin the beauty of the area, but it also contributes to environmental contamination.

How much is a street sweeping ticket in Long Beach?

The city's most expensive parking ticket is $360, the fine assessed for illegally parking in a disabled parking space. The cost for being parked on the wrong side of the street on street sweeping days was increased to $70, and is estimated to generate about $918,000 for the city next year.

Where can I park for street cleaning?

Parking (on any day) is allowed on the apron, which is the sloped area between the street and the sidewalk leading up to your driveway. Your vehicle can overhang onto the parkway at either end of the apron, but not the sidewalk. Citations are only issued when a vehicle is immediately in the way of the sweeper.
